Slab demolition services involve the careful removal of concrete floors, driveways, patios, or foundation sections that need to be replaced, repaired, or cleared for new construction. This process typically uses specialized equipment to break up and remove existing concrete efficiently and safely. Contractors experienced in slab demolition can handle projects of various sizes, ensuring that the removal is thorough and that the surrounding structures remain unaffected. Whether it's a residential driveway that has cracked over time or a basement floor that needs to be replaced, professional slab demolition provides a clean slate for future building or renovation projects.

Many property owners turn to slab demolition services when dealing with structural issues or planning upgrades. Problems such as uneven surfaces, cracks, or deteriorating concrete can compromise safety and curb appeal. Demolishing the old slab allows for proper inspection and repair of underlying issues before installing a new foundation or floor. Additionally, slab removal may be necessary to create space for new additions or to reconfigure property layouts. Service providers can assist in assessing the condition of existing slabs and recommend the best approach to ensure a stable and level base for future construction or landscaping.

This type of service is commonly used on residential properties, especially for driveways, garages, basements, and patios. It is also frequently needed on commercial sites that require the removal of old concrete slabs to prepare for new structures or upgrades. Properties with concrete slabs that have suffered significant damage, such as cracking, sinking, or spalling, often require professional demolition before new concrete can be poured. Homeowners planning to expand their living space or improve outdoor areas also benefit from the expertise of contractors who specialize in slab removal, ensuring the process is completed safely and efficiently.

The overview below groups typical Slab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Saint George, UT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Slab Removals - typical costs range from $250-$600 for many routine jobs, such as removing a single sidewalk or small patio slab. Most projects fall within this middle range, with fewer exceeding $600 for more involved work.

Medium Demolition Projects - larger, more complex slab demolitions, like removing an entire driveway or garage floor, generally cost between $1,000-$3,000. These projects are common and often require additional debris removal or site preparation.

Full Slab Replacement - replacing an entire slab, including excavation and new concrete pouring, can range from $3,500-$8,000 depending on size and site conditions. Larger or more intricate replacements tend to push costs into the higher end of this range.

Specialized or Large-Scale Demolition - extensive projects, such as commercial slabs or multiple structures, can reach $10,000 or more. These are less frequent and typically involve complex logistics or heavy-duty equipment.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is slab demolition? Slab demolition involves safely removing concrete slabs from a property, typically to prepare for renovations or new construction projects.

Why might I need slab demolition services? Slab demolition may be necessary for foundation repairs, basement modifications, or to clear space for new structures.

How do local contractors handle slab demolition? Contractors use specialized equipment and techniques to break up and remove concrete efficiently, ensuring minimal disruption to the surrounding area.

Are there different methods of slab demolition? Yes, methods vary from hand tools for small areas to heavy machinery like jackhammers and excavators for larger slabs.

What should I consider before hiring a slab demolition service? It's important to assess the scope of the project, ensure the contractor has experience with similar jobs, and verify they follow safety guidelines.
